What is the hose coming out of rear differential?
The hose coming out of the rear differential is typically the vent hose. Its purpose is to equalize pressure inside the differential as the fluid expands and contracts with temperature changes, preventing leaks and maintaining proper lubrication. If this hose is damaged or blocked, it can lead to pressure buildup, which may cause seals to fail or fluid to leak out. Regular inspection of the hose can help ensure the differential operates efficiently.

How do you fill Chevy truck differential?
To fill a Chevy truck differential, first, locate the fill plug, which is typically on the side of the differential housing. Remove the fill plug using a wrench or socket, and use a fluid pump or a funnel to add the appropriate differential fluid until it reaches the bottom of the fill hole. Once filled, securely replace the fill plug and ensure there are no leaks. Always refer to your owner's manual for the correct type of fluid and specifications.

What gear ratio is best for towing?
The best gear ratio for towing typically falls between 3.55 and 4.10, depending on the vehicle and the weight of the load. A lower gear ratio (like 3.55) is better for fuel efficiency on lighter loads and highway driving, while a higher ratio (like 4.10) provides more torque, enhancing towing capability for heavier loads. It's important to consider the specific vehicle and its engine performance when selecting the optimal gear ratio for towing. Always refer to the manufacturer's recommendations for the best results.

What supports the pinion gear in the differential housing?
In a differential housing, the pinion gear is supported by bearings, typically tapered roller bearings or ball bearings, which allow for smooth rotation and alignment. These bearings are mounted on the differential case and provide stability while accommodating the axial and radial loads generated during operation. Additionally, the pinion gear is secured by a crush sleeve or spacer, which helps maintain proper bearing preload and alignment. This setup ensures efficient power transfer and longevity of the differential system.
What direction if 1 gear is turend do the others turn in?
When one gear is turned, the adjacent gears will turn in the opposite direction. For example, if you turn a gear clockwise, the gear directly connected to it will turn counterclockwise. This alternating motion continues through the sequence of connected gears. Thus, each gear's direction of rotation alternates with its neighbors.
